Lincoln County is located in the U.S. state of Nebraska. Its county seat and largest city is North Platte. The county lies in the Nebraska Sandhills region and covers a total area of 2,575 square miles, making it the third-largest county in Nebraska by area. It is situated in the central-western part of the state and is part of the North Platte Micropolitan Statistical Area. Lincoln County is bordered by McPherson County to the northwest, Logan County to the northeast, Custer and Dawson Counties to the east, Frontier County to the southeast, Hayes County to the southwest, and Perkins and Keith Counties to the west. The county observes Central Time and includes major highways such as Interstate 80 and U.S. Highways 30 and 83
